Location/Address689A Choa Chu Kang Drive Singapore 681689
753 CHOA CHU KANG NORTH 5SINGAPORE 680753 1.239 KM AWAY
8 SUNGEI KADUT STREET 3SINGAPORE 729154 1.6 KM AWAY
126 PENDING ROAD #01-306SINGAPORE 670126 3.676 KM AWAY